Sound Quality
:
10
I've been playing Yamaha Pacifica Guitars for over 15 years exclusively. The unit came with a power supply called a "Power Pad II" that literally takes away any ground noise that is ever there. BONE QUIET!! I use this pedal board to fly into gigs, so the amps I use are preferably Framus, but Marshall JCM 900's are the norm. My pedals always sound consistantly great when powered from this power supply.
Reliability
:
10
I've had this unit for over 2 years now and it's bullet-proof. It's taken a beating too! I fly out for gigs just about every weekend, and the airlines beat the crap out of it. I open it up when I get to the gig and everything works great. Again, the design is ideal for the type of brutal air traveling that is associated with my gigs. I tried 2 other brands of "pedal boards" before I found out about MKS and they pale in comparison.
